What does "taboo" mean?

  1. noun A subject, word, or action that is avoided or forbidden because of strong social or cultural disapproval.
    "Discussing salaries openly is still something of a taboo at the office."
  2. adj Forbidden or avoided by social custom rather than by law.
    "The topic of her divorce was taboo at family dinners."
